Abstract

The invention belongs to the technical field of vehicles, and relates to a driving safety monitoring method, a vehicle-mounted terminal and a computer readable storage medium, wherein the driving safety monitoring method comprises the following steps: and acquiring image information of a region corresponding to the driving position. And when the suspected dangerous driving behavior of the driver is obtained according to the image information, confirming the dangerous driving behavior. And when the driver is confirmed to have dangerous driving behaviors, reminding operation is carried out. Therefore, when the driver is judged to have the suspected dangerous driving behavior according to the acquired image information of the area corresponding to the driving position, the method and the device can perform further confirmation operation of the dangerous driving behavior, so that the judgment operation can be performed twice before the driver is confirmed to have the dangerous driving behavior, the purpose of reducing the misjudgment probability of the dangerous driving behavior can be achieved, a more accurate driving safety detection mode is provided for a user, and the use experience of the user is improved.

Background
Safety is the most basic requirement of people for driving and traveling, wherein the first condition of safety traveling requires that a driver follows the relevant regulations of traffic regulations to drive, for example, a safety belt is fastened, the driver does not make a call during driving, the driver does not smoke in a cab, and the like.
With the rapid development of the camera technology and the image recognition technology, the automatic detection of the violation of the driver in the driving process by using the image detection technology has become a research hotspot of the current intelligent traffic.
However, the method of detecting whether the driver has an illegal behavior or a dangerous driving behavior in the driving process only by means of image detection and image recognition technology uses only a single judgment condition, so that the probability of misjudgment is high, and the use experience of the user is poor.
In view of the above problems, those skilled in the art have sought solutions.

A driving safety monitoring method according to a first embodiment of the present invention includes:
and S11, acquiring image information of the area corresponding to the driving position.
In one embodiment, in step S11, image information of the area corresponding to the driving seat is collected, wherein the image information may include, but is not limited to, at least one of a steering wheel image, a driver image, a seat belt image, and the like.
In one embodiment, the step of collecting the image information of the area corresponding to the driving seat in step S11 may include, but is not limited to: and acquiring image information of an area corresponding to the driving position through one or more camera devices.
In one embodiment, the step of acquiring the image information of the area corresponding to the driving seat in step S11 may include, but is not limited to: and when the vehicle is started or runs, acquiring the image information of the area corresponding to the driving position in real time.
And S12, confirming the dangerous driving behavior when the suspected dangerous driving behavior of the driver is obtained according to the image information.
In one embodiment, the step of performing the dangerous driving behavior confirmation operation when it is acquired from the image information that the driver has the suspected dangerous driving behavior at step S12 may include, but is not limited to: and when the abnormal driving action of the driver is obtained according to the image information, judging that the suspected dangerous driving action exists in the driver. And carrying out dangerous driving behavior confirmation operation.
In an embodiment, the abnormal driving action may include, but is not limited to, a physical abnormal action and/or a distracting driving action, among others.
In an embodiment, among others, the body abnormal action may include, but is not limited to: at least one of a body twitch, an eye-closing duration exceeding a first preset duration, a yawning frequency exceeding a preset frequency, a head-lowering duration exceeding a second preset duration, and the like.
In an embodiment, wherein the distracting driving action may include, but is not limited to: at least one of a lowering motion, a motion of disengaging at least one hand from a steering wheel, a smoking motion, and the like.
In one embodiment, the step S11 of collecting the image information of the area corresponding to the driving seat may include, but is not limited to: and acquiring image information of an area corresponding to the driving position through a 3D camera device. When it is acquired from the image information that there is an abnormal driving action of the driver, the step of determining that there is a suspected dangerous driving behavior of the driver may include, but is not limited to: and 3D modeling is carried out according to the image information to judge whether the driver has abnormal driving actions. And when judging that the driver has abnormal driving actions, judging that the driver has suspected dangerous driving behaviors. When it is determined that there is no abnormal driving operation by the driver, the process returns to step S1: and acquiring image information of a region corresponding to the driving position. Therefore, the driving safety monitoring method provided by the embodiment adopts the 3D camera device to identify the driving action of the driver, and can improve the accuracy of identifying the driving action of the driver.
And S13, when the driver is confirmed to have dangerous driving behaviors, reminding operation is carried out.
In one embodiment, the step of performing the dangerous driving behavior confirmation operation may include, but is not limited to: and acquiring the use state information and/or user physiological information of the associated owner terminal. And judging whether the use state information and/or the user physiological information meet the preset dangerous driving condition. In step S13, when it is determined that the driver has dangerous driving behavior, the reminding operation may include, but is not limited to: and when the use state information and/or the user physiological information accord with preset dangerous driving conditions, confirming that the driver has dangerous driving behaviors, and performing reminding operation.
In one embodiment, before the step of obtaining the usage state information and/or the user physiological information of the associated owner terminal, the method may include, but is not limited to: and associating with the owner terminal through a wireless communication technology. Wherein the wireless communication technology may include, but is not limited to, at least one of bluetooth communication technology, server communication technology, WiFi communication technology.
In one embodiment, the wireless communication technology is a bluetooth communication technology or a WiFi communication technology. The step of associating with the owner terminal through the wireless communication technology may include, but is not limited to, sending communication authentication information to the owner terminal through the NFC module after establishing an NFC connection with the owner terminal. And acquiring a communication connection request sent by the owner terminal according to the communication authentication information so as to be automatically associated with the owner terminal through a wireless communication technology. The communication authentication information may include, but is not limited to, a communication identifier and a communication connection password.
In an embodiment, when the driving safety monitoring method provided in this embodiment is applied to the vehicle-mounted terminal in the shared vehicle, the communication authentication information in the NFC module is changed every time it is used, so as to ensure that each piece of communication authentication information can only be used once, thereby enabling the shared vehicle to be safer.
In one embodiment, the owner terminal may be, but is not limited to, at least one of a mobile phone, a tablet computer, a notebook computer, a smart game console, and the like. The use state information of the owner terminal includes an unused state or a being used state. Wherein the state of being used, such as a call state, a touch screen operated state, and the like.
In an embodiment, the user physiological information may include, but is not limited to, at least one of heart rate information, blood pressure information, pulse information, and body temperature information. The user physiological information may be, but is not limited to, acquired by the wearable terminal. Wearable terminals, such as smart watches, smart bracelets, and the like.
In one embodiment, the user physiological information in the owner terminal may be acquired by the owner terminal itself (i.e., the owner terminal is a wearable terminal). In other embodiments, the user physiological information in the owner terminal may be acquired and transmitted by the wearable terminal.
In an embodiment, referring to fig. 2, the step of determining that the driver has the driving behavior suspected of being dangerous when the abnormal driving action is acquired from the image information may include, but is not limited to: and S21, judging that the driver has the suspected dangerous driving behavior when the driver has the head lowering action and/or the action that at least one hand is separated from the steering wheel is obtained according to the image information. In the step of performing the dangerous driving behavior confirmation operation, the steps may include, but are not limited to: and S22, judging whether the detected usage state information of the associated owner terminal is in a usage state.
In an embodiment, referring to fig. 2, the step of performing the reminding operation when the driver is determined to have dangerous driving behavior may include, but is not limited to: and S23, when the use state information of the associated owner terminal is in the use state (namely, when the use state information meets the preset dangerous driving condition), performing reminding operation.
In one embodiment, referring to fig. 2, after the step of determining whether the detected usage status information of the associated owner terminal is in the usage status at step S22, the method may include, but is not limited to: when the usage state information of the associated owner terminal is not in the in-use state, the process returns to step S11: and acquiring image information of a region corresponding to the driving position.
In an embodiment, when the usage state information of the associated owner terminal is in a usage state, the step of performing the reminding operation may include, but is not limited to: and carrying out corresponding control operation on the owner terminal to prevent the driver from continuing to use the owner terminal. The operation is controlled, for example, the screen-off operation is controlled, and the operation of displaying the reminding information on the interface of the owner terminal is controlled.
In an embodiment, when the usage state information of the associated owner terminal is in a usage state, the step of performing the reminding operation may include, but is not limited to: and when the use state information of the associated owner terminal is in the use state, acquiring the current vehicle speed. And when the current vehicle speed is greater than the preset vehicle speed, reminding operation is carried out.
In an embodiment, specifically, in the driving safety monitoring method provided in this embodiment, when it is obtained that there is a distracting driving action, such as a head-down action and/or an action that at least one hand is disengaged from a steering wheel, of the driver according to the image information, it is determined that there is a suspected dangerous driving action of the driver, and then when it is obtained that the usage state information of the associated vehicle owner terminal is in a usage state, it can be accurately determined that there is a dangerous driving action of a mobile phone when the driver starts driving, and a prompt (e.g., a vehicle alarm prompt) can be sent to the user and/or a corresponding control operation is performed on the vehicle owner terminal to prevent the driver from continuing to use the vehicle owner terminal, so as to achieve the purpose of ensuring the driving safety of the driver.
In one embodiment, the abnormal driving motion is a physical abnormal motion. When the use state information and/or the user physiological information meet the preset dangerous driving condition, it is determined that the driver has dangerous driving behavior, and the step of performing the reminding operation may include, but is not limited to: and when the physiological information of the user accords with a preset dangerous driving condition and/or a preset rescue condition, confirming that the driver has dangerous driving behaviors. And carrying out reminding operation and/or rescue operation.
In one embodiment, the physiological information of the user corresponds to a preset dangerous driving condition, for example, the physiological information of the user corresponds to fatigue driving physiological information, the body temperature of the physiological information of the user is higher or lower than a preset body temperature, the heart rate of the physiological information of the user is higher or lower than a preset heart rate, and the like.
In one embodiment, the physiological information of the user meets preset dangerous driving conditions and preset rescue conditions, for example, the body temperature in the physiological information of the user is higher or lower than a preset body temperature, the heart rate in the physiological information of the user is higher or lower than a preset heart rate, and the like.
In one embodiment, the step of performing the reminding operation and/or the rescuing operation may include, but is not limited to: and contacting the rescue terminal and/or controlling the vehicle to automatically drive.
In an embodiment, the rescue terminal may include, but is not limited to, at least one of a vehicle terminal, a police terminal, an ambulance terminal, a family terminal, and the like within a preset distance range.
In one embodiment, the step of contacting the rescue terminal may include, but is not limited to: and sending the positioning information and/or rescued person information and/or license plate number to the rescue terminal. The rescued person information may include, but is not limited to, at least one of a rescued person's name, phone number, emergency contact information, age information, user physiological information, and the like.
In one embodiment, the step of controlling the vehicle to perform automatic driving may include, but is not limited to: and acquiring the positioning information and the safety place information of the mobile phone. And acquiring navigation information according to the positioning information and the safety place information. And controlling the vehicle to automatically drive according to the navigation information. The safe place information may be, but is not limited to, a delivery address, an address of a nearby hospital, and the like.
In an embodiment, specifically, the driving safety detection method provided in this embodiment can not only send an alarm prompt to a user when the driver is in fatigue driving, but also perform automatic driving control when the driver experiences sudden physical discomfort, so as to ensure the driving safety of the driver and the road traffic safety.
In one embodiment, the distracting driving maneuver is a smoking maneuver. In the step of performing the dangerous driving behavior confirmation operation, the steps may include, but are not limited to: and acquiring feedback information of the smoke sensing device. And judging whether the feedback information meets the preset dangerous driving condition. In step S13, when it is determined that the driver has dangerous driving behavior, the reminding operation may include, but is not limited to: and when the feedback information meets the preset dangerous driving condition, reminding operation is carried out. Therefore, the driving safety monitoring method provided by the embodiment can accurately monitor that the driver is a dangerous driving behavior with driving smoke, and sends out reminding information to the driver when the driver is a dangerous driving behavior with driving smoke so as to guarantee the travel safety of the driver.
